Product Description
Aztec Camera was part of the early 80's new wave movement. Lead by Scottish singer/songwriter Roddy Frame, they issued numerous albums well into the 90's. This CD is a two-on-one featuring their second album Knife from 1984 plus a six song EP, Aztec Camera, that features their unique studio version of Van Halen's 'Jump', the studio version of 'The Boy Wonders', plus four live versions of their best songs. Both of these albums made the Billboard charts. Wounded Bird Records. 2002.

4.0 out of 5 stars good british 80's pop, July 16, 2002
By "mskarmar" (ocean view, de United States) - See all my reviews
Aztec Camera (ie Roddy Frame) was making great british guitar pop in the 80's and then fizzled in the 90's after the album Love. This is a great reissue of their best album paired with the hard to find ep which includes a great version of Van Halen's 'Jump'. Mark Knopfler produced and the sound quality is present. This is solid music that shouldn't be forgotten....ps- check out the web site for wounded bird records (good reissue stuff).

5.0 out of 5 stars Perfect, July 16, 2004
By Antonio Lopez Suanzes (Pozuelo de Alarcon, Madrid Spain)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This is the best album from Aztec Camera. Easily, one of the best ot the 80's.

Many songs from this record are melted with some of my best moments in those years. They are beautiful pop jewels: All I need is everything, just like the USA, Still on fire, Knife, Backwards and Forwards (It's unbelievable that this last song is not incuded in "the best" album) ...

Apart from the exceptional inspiration Roddy Frame delivers throughout the work, there are two things that I love and find almost unparalleled in any other pop cd from that decade: the sound of the guitars and the sense that this album is something more than a bunch of songs put together in a cd: there's a common feeling and sound behind the tracks that link them together, giving a unique sense to the work, making it whole and cohesive, and definitely more than the sum of its parts. Congratulations to the producer.

It's for this reason that I don't agree with previous reviewers: the EP songs included only add up minutes. Quality, wholeness and integrity are mortally wounded.
